Reporting to the EMEA Finance Director, the Procure‑to‑Pay (P2P) Accountant is a key member of the Colliers EMEA Shared Services Centre (SSC), responsible for delivering efficient and compliant end‑to‑end P2P operations. The role ensures accurate and timely supplier invoice processing and payment execution, adherence to internal controls and external requirements, and supports audit, tax, and statutory compliance activities across the EMEA region.
Key Purpose of Role:
To deliver efficient, accurate, and compliant Procure‑to‑Pay operations across the business, ensuring timely processing of supplier invoices and payments, strong vendor relationships, and adherence to internal controls and statutory requirements. The P2P Accountant plays a key role in supporting business operations by maintaining high‑quality transactional accounting, driving process improvements, and partnering closely with internal stakeholders and external suppliers.
